ARM Cortex-A15 MPCore 处理器技术详解

需积分: 32 1 下载量 137 浏览量 更新于2024-07-16 收藏 2.92MB PDF 举报
"该文档是ARM Cortex-A15 MPCore处理器的技术参考手册,涵盖了Cortex-A15处理器的详细规格和功能。Cortex-A15是基于ARMv7-A架构的高性能、低功耗多核处理器,适用于各种计算密集型应用。手册由ARM公司发布,版本为r4p0,版权日期为2011-2013年。" 在该技术参考手册中,读者可以了解到以下关键知识点: 1. **ARMv7-A架构**:Cortex-A15是基于ARMv7-A架构的,这是ARM设计的一个先进指令集架构,支持64位数据处理和多线程,提供了高级的功能和性能,同时保持了与早期ARM架构的兼容性。 2. **高性能和低功耗**:Cortex-A15处理器旨在提供强大的计算能力,同时优化能源效率,这使其成为移动设备、服务器和嵌入式系统等领域的理想选择。 3. **多核设计(MPCore)**:Cortex-A15 MPCore支持多核心配置,允许处理器并行执行多个任务,从而提高了整体系统性能。每个核心都可以独立运行不同的任务,提升了处理器的灵活性和效率。 4. **处理器特性**:手册会详细介绍Cortex-A15的各种特性,如乱序执行、超标量处理、高速缓存系统、内存管理单元(MMU)、硬件浮点运算支持(VFP)、NEON媒体处理引擎等。 5. **接口和总线**:Cortex-A15处理器与系统的其他组件通过特定的接口和总线连接,如Advanced eXtensible Interface (AXI)总线,用于高效的数据传输。 6. **中断和异常处理**:手册将涵盖处理器如何响应中断和异常,包括中断向量表、中断处理流程以及异常处理机制,这些都是实时操作系统(RTOS)和多任务环境的关键部分。 7. **调试和开发工具**:Cortex-A15支持多种调试技术,如JTAG和DAP(Debug Access Port),方便开发者进行程序调试和性能分析。 8. **电源管理**:Cortex-A15具备精细的电源管理机制,如动态电压频率调整(DVFS)和睡眠模式,有助于降低系统功耗。 9. **知识产权保护**:ARM强调其文档中的信息受版权保护,未经许可,不得复制或以物质形式改编。同时,手册中提到的产品可能会不断进行开发和改进,所有细节和使用方法均按良好信念提供,但不提供任何明示或暗示的保证。 10. **第三方商标和所有权**:手册中可能提及的其他品牌和名称可能是各自所有者的商标,应尊重这些知识产权。 此技术参考手册对于开发者、系统架构师和工程师来说是宝贵的资源,他们可以通过深入理解Cortex-A15的内部工作原理,优化软件性能,以及设计和实现高效的基于Cortex-A15的系统。